Prove Product Marketing Value Like a Cordial PMM
Q: What are the six steps of the playbook discussed?
Step one: pick the metric to own; Step two: develop the message and pre-work with trackers; Step three: rollout and training; Step four: run the experiment and collect data; Step five: share the results; Step six: maintain a feedback loop to iterate messaging.
Prove Product Marketing Value Like a Cordial PMM
Q: How did Gong help prove the new narrative's impact?
They created trackers in Gong to capture the essence of the POV and position, split reps into high-adoption versus low-adoption groups, and correlated messaging adoption with downstream sales metrics to show faster deal progression and higher close rates.
Prove Product Marketing Value Like a Cordial PMM
Q: What was the core problem PMMs faced when trying to prove impact?
PMMs struggled to link messaging to revenue because many metrics looked appealing but weren't clearly connected to business outcomes; the guest emphasized choosing one primary metric and building a simple, repeatable process to prove impact.

Frequently Asked Questions About Product Marketing Adventures

What is Product Marketing Adventures about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This show centers on practical product marketing execution, featuring case-study style explorations of real campaigns and hands-on messaging critiques of notable companies. Episodes commonly cover topics like building platform and product storytelling, go-to-market strategies, stakeholder management, change management, and leveraging customer insights to drive adoption and revenue. A notable strength is the mix of in-depth PMM discipline with actionable guidance, including workshops, messaging frameworks, and lessons learned from high-growth tech environments.
